Job description

The Proposal Procurement Lead (estimator) is an individual contributor role that is responsible for determining the current/expected material costs of Veolia Water Tech‑supplied equipment to establish the budget during the project execution.

This role can be performed from any of our key sites in the U.S.A. or Canada: Trevose, Pennsylvania; Norfolk, Virginia; Minnetonka, Minnesota; Boulder, Colorado; Houston, Texas; Oakville, Ontario.

Duties & Responsibilities
  • Partner strategically to help win projects, ensuring successful execution and improved margins.
  • Collaborate with stakeholders—Project Proposal, Sales Category, Engineering, Logistics, Quality, and Procurement—to develop optimal cost strategies covering materials and procurement labor.
  • Coordinate and lead project teams focused on procurement during the tender phase.
  • Guide project cost strategy using quotations, vendor contracts, material costing database, cost standards, and historical data.
  • Develop and maintain cost‑standard tools and records for future costing.
  • Collaborate with project execution teams on cost strategy transfer and Return‑on‑Experience (REX).
  • Evaluate risk and contingencies to be included in proposal material costing; monitor current and expected market conditions affecting costs.
  • Maintain proficiency with company software such as Google Suite and SAP.
  • Adhere to the Company Values, Ethics, and Safety Policies.
  • Provide cost estimation for 3rd‑party material costs.
